Pennsylvania Man Suspected of Drugs in Sword Stabbing Death

State police say a Pennsylvania man was repeatedly stabbed with a 22-inch sword, and they are chasing leads that his killing may be drug-related.

The 37-year-old man was found dead in a home at about 1:45 a.m. Thursday in Blairsville, a small town about 45 miles east of Pittsburgh.

Police took items they believed to be drug paraphernalia from the house and said they had several "persons of interest" but no suspects in the case.

The Indiana County coroner is not releasing details at the request of police.

Blairsville police are investigating the case with state troopers.

Police Chief Mike Allman says the victim isn't a native of Blairsville.
